Marty J. Dupra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Marty J. Dupra of Fort Covington, New York, born in Saranac Lake, New York, who passed away on May 15, 2021 at the age of 38.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

He was predeceased by: his grandparents, Levi, Mildred Dupra, Howard and Kathleen Yaddow; and his uncle Donald Dustin.

He is survived by: his parents, Loren J. Dupra and Cathy Yaddow Dupra; his brother Matthew; his sister-in-law April Dupra of Fort Covington, NY; his significant other Brandy Brown; his significant other's son Wyatt Wilson; his niece Mackenzie J. Dupra; and his godson Alex J. Dupra of Fort Covington, NY. He is also survived by several a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.

Donations may be made in Marty's name to the Spring Cove Hunting Club or to the Go Fund Me page set up to help with the funeral expenses and his future son's needs.
